A CREATIVE CUISINE & AMAZING SIGNATURE DISHES!
L'Avenue Carnot offers you a creative, delicious cuisine and tasty signature dishes. Chef Pascal Chollet, at the helm of this refined cuisine, offers you a unique culinary experience and shares his passion for cooking in every plate.
After 25 years in the kitchens of Le Scopitone, a real Bordeaux institution on rue de la Vieille Tour, chef Pascal Chollet's talent and culinary mastery no longer need to be proven.
The signature dishes offered by the chef are striking, delicious and pull you into his culinary world: sweetbread with langoustines, duck magret in a crust, garlic-roasted pigeons stuffed with foie gras… The textures, the colours, the cooking… the cuisine is creative, delicious and inspiring.
